Nehemiah 12:40

Context

12:40 Then the two choirs that gave thanks took their stations 1  in the temple of God. I did also, along with half the officials with me,

Nehemiah 2:12

Context
2:12 I got up during the night, along with a few men who were with me. But I did not tell anyone what my God was putting on my heart to do for Jerusalem. There were no animals with me, except for the one 2  I was riding.

Nehemiah 2:9

Context
2:9 Then I went to the governors of Trans-Euphrates, and I presented to them the letters from the king. The king had sent with me officers of the army and horsemen.

Nehemiah 9:30

Context
9:30 You prolonged your kindness 3  with them for many years, and you solemnly admonished them by your Spirit through your prophets. Still they paid no attention, 4  so you delivered them into the hands of the neighboring peoples. 5

[12:40]  1 tn Heb “stood.”

[2:12]  2 tn Heb “the animal.”

[9:30]  3 tn The Hebrew expression here is elliptical. The words “your kindness” are not included in the Hebrew text, but have been supplied in the translation for clarity.

[9:30]  4 tn Heb “did not give ear to.”

[9:30]  5 tn Heb “the peoples of the lands.”
